Understanding ADHD
Before diving into online ADHD tests, it's important to comprehend what ADHD is. ADHD is a neurodevelopmental disorder characterized by consistent patterns of negligence, hyperactivity, and impulsivity. Symptoms might consist of:
Difficulty sustaining attentionDifficulty organizing jobsImpulsivenessExcessive fidgeting or uneasynessKinds of ADHD
ADHD is primarily categorized into 3 types:
Predominantly Inattentive Presentation: Characterized primarily by neglectful habits.Primarily Hyperactive-Impulsive Presentation: Marked by hyperactivity and spontaneous habits.Integrated Presentation: A mix of both inattentive and hyperactive-impulsive symptoms.Online ADHD Tests: Overview
The increase of online ADHD tests presents a practical alternative for individuals who might be hesitant to look for assistance through conventional routes. These tests typically include self-report surveys that evaluate symptoms related to ADHD. However, it's vital to keep in mind that these tests are not diagnostic tools; they serve as preliminary evaluations that can suggest whether more assessment is required.

Many online ADHD tests follow a structured format that typically includes:

Questionnaire Format: Participants respond to multiple-choice concerns about their behaviors, feelings, and experiences over a specific time period (often the last six months).

Scoring and Output: Upon conclusion, the responses yield a rating that suggests the probability of having High Functioning ADHD Test. A higher rating usually shows higher levels of ADHD symptoms.

Recommendations: Many tests provide customized suggestions on steps to take if symptoms are determined, consisting of suggestions for speaking with a healthcare expert.

If the online ADHD test recommends you may have adhd Test online Uk, the next steps include:

Consult a Medical Professional: Seek a qualified psychiatrist, psychologist, or general practitioner for an examination.

More Assessment: Be ready for an extensive assessment that could include structured interviews, behavioral observations, and possibly physical exams.

Consider Treatment Options: If diagnosed, treatment alternatives may consist of therapy, medication, or a mix of both.
